Technical Service Line Coordinator - Operating Room - Full Time Days

Hackensack Meridian Health is dedicated to transforming healthcare and positively impacting the community. The Technical Service Line Coordinator for the Operating Room is responsible for supporting training, managing inventory, ensuring patient care, and maintaining safety standards in the operating room environment.

Responsibilities

Practices under direct supervision of an RN. Acts as a Preceptor working closely with the OR Educator. Supports a training philosophy and acts to facilitate this program on a daily basis. Assists with in-service and training for staff on specialty related equipment and instrumentation related to their service line oversight. Provides on-going review of related topics to personnel at all levels. Functions as scrub in OR, as needed: Performs all duties as expected. Maintains up-to-date preference cards in specialty and reviews with physicians as necessary: Documents and makes changes into the system to ensure lists are accurate. Maintains current knowledge of technical developments and use of instrumentation and equipment: Remains competent in the use of appropriate surgical equipment
Reviews and monitors daily environmental surveillance such as temperature and humidity, medical waste disposal, sterilization logs and other duties as assigned. Surveillance is performed on a daily basis and acceptable levels are maintained. Works with SPD to obtain recommended policies and parameters to effectively provide sterilization of equipment/instrumentation
Establishes, implements and maintains an inventory control system for supplies in assigned area in coordination with manager and physicians: Inventory control system is functioning accurately and all staff is trained to utilize the system properly on an ongoing basis. Ensures all supplies and equipment are available and functioning in assigned areas prior to case and coordinates with physicians and materials manager: Makes rounds to ensure the necessary equipment and supplies are available. Attends Scheduling Huddle to coordinate any equipment conflicts. Acts as a liaison between OR, Materials Management and BioMed to fulfill needs
Provides quality patient care as outlined in Perioperative Standards of Care and the Department's policy and Procedures
Maintains a safe environment by strict adherence to established safety principles and practice, including but not limited to: universal precautions, electrical hazards, hazardous waste, positioning, and aseptic technique. Is able to provide correct response to each situation in a timely, efficient and calm manner
Working with RN, delegates work assignments to the appropriate team members to ensure quick, safe room turn overs, equipment preparation and transport/monitoring patients all following established protocols in established time frame. Work is delegated among available knowledgeable staff
Assists in supply product evaluation and recommends cost effectiveness of solutions. Assists with cost saving initiatives, working with the leadership and Business manager of the OR
Coordinates pre-procedure phone calls, post-procedure phone calls, and data collection for Outcomes studies/PI projects
Other duties and/or projects as assigned
Adheres to HMH Organizational competencies and standards of behavior
Lifts a minimum of 5 lbs., pushes and pulls a minimum of 5 lbs. and stands a minimum of 1 hour a day
